Oilers assign Puljujarvi to AHL

Jesse Puljujarvi is off to Bakersfield.
The Edmonton Oilers announced Monday that the team has assigned the rookie winger to its AHL affiliate, the Bakersfield Condors.
Puljujarvi has appeared in 28 games this season, scoring one goal and seven assists, with his lone goal on the year coming in the season opener.
The Finnish forward was scratched for Edmonton's last two games and played just 3:27 in his last appearance, a game in which he saw just one shift after the opening period.
In another roster move on Monday, the Oilers also placed goaltender Jonas Gustavsson on waivers.
